| void AnsaOspf6::NeighborStateLoading::ProcessEvent | ( | AnsaOspf6::Neighbor * | neighbor, |
| Neighbor::NeighborEventType | event | ||
| ) | [private, virtual] |
Implements AnsaOspf6::NeighborState.
Definition at line 28 of file ansaOspfNeighborStateLoading6.cc.
{
if ((event == AnsaOspf6::Neighbor::KillNeighbor) || (event == AnsaOspf6::Neighbor::LinkDown)){
MessageHandler* messageHandler =
neighbor->GetInterface()->GetArea()->GetRouter()->GetMessageHandler();
neighbor->Reset();
messageHandler->ClearTimer(neighbor->GetInactivityTimer());
ChangeState(neighbor, new AnsaOspf6::NeighborStateDown, this);
}
if (event == AnsaOspf6::Neighbor::InactivityTimer){
neighbor->Reset();
if (neighbor->GetInterface()->GetType() == AnsaOspf6::Interface::NBMA){
MessageHandler* messageHandler =
neighbor->GetInterface()->GetArea()->GetRouter()->GetMessageHandler();
messageHandler->StartTimer(neighbor->GetPollTimer(),
neighbor->GetInterface()->GetPollInterval());
}
ChangeState(neighbor, new AnsaOspf6::NeighborStateDown, this);
}
if (event == AnsaOspf6::Neighbor::OneWayReceived){
neighbor->Reset();
ChangeState(neighbor, new AnsaOspf6::NeighborStateInit, this);
}
if (event == AnsaOspf6::Neighbor::HelloReceived){
MessageHandler* messageHandler =
neighbor->GetInterface()->GetArea()->GetRouter()->GetMessageHandler();
messageHandler->ClearTimer(neighbor->GetInactivityTimer());
messageHandler->StartTimer(neighbor->GetInactivityTimer(), neighbor->GetRouterDeadInterval());
}
if (event == AnsaOspf6::Neighbor::LoadingDone){
neighbor->ClearRequestRetransmissionTimer();
ChangeState(neighbor, new AnsaOspf6::NeighborStateFull, this);
}
if (event == AnsaOspf6::Neighbor::IsAdjacencyOK){
if (!neighbor->NeedAdjacency()){
neighbor->Reset();
ChangeState(neighbor, new AnsaOspf6::NeighborStateTwoWay, this);
}
}
if ((event == AnsaOspf6::Neighbor::SequenceNumberMismatch) || (event
== AnsaOspf6::Neighbor::BadLinkStateRequest)){
MessageHandler* messageHandler =
neighbor->GetInterface()->GetArea()->GetRouter()->GetMessageHandler();
neighbor->Reset();
neighbor->IncrementDDSequenceNumber();
neighbor->SendDatabaseDescriptionPacket(true);
messageHandler->StartTimer(neighbor->GetDDRetransmissionTimer(),
neighbor->GetInterface()->GetRetransmissionInterval());
ChangeState(neighbor, new AnsaOspf6::NeighborStateExchangeStart, this);
}
if (event == AnsaOspf6::Neighbor::RequestRetransmissionTimer){
neighbor->SendLinkStateRequestPacket();
neighbor->StartRequestRetransmissionTimer();
}
if (event == AnsaOspf6::Neighbor::UpdateRetransmissionTimer){
neighbor->RetransmitUpdatePacket();
neighbor->StartUpdateRetransmissionTimer();
}
if (event == AnsaOspf6::Neighbor::DDRetransmissionTimer){
neighbor->DeleteLastSentDDPacket();
}
}
